    The Texas state sales and use tax rate is 6.25%, but local taxing jurisdictions (cities, counties, special purpose districts, and transit authorities) may also impose sales and use tax up to 2% for a total maximum combined rate of 8.25%.

    . Who is required to hold a Texas sales and use tax permit?
    You must obtain a Texas sales and use tax permit if you are engaged in business in Texas and you:
    • sell tangible personal property in Texas;
    • lease tangible personal property in Texas; or
    • sell taxable services in Texas.
    2. What is tangible personal property?
    The statutory definition for "tangible personal property" is "personal property that can be seen, weighed, measured, felt, or touched or that is perceptible to the senses.
    3. What is engaged in business?
    A person or a retailer is engaged in business in Texas if any of the following criteria are met:
    • (A) maintains, occupies, or uses an office, place of distribution, sales or sample room, warehouse or storage place, or other place of business;
    • (B) has any representative, agent, salesperson, canvasser, or solicitor who operates in this state under the authority of the seller to sell, deliver, or take orders for any taxable items;
    • (C) promotes a flea market, trade day, or other event that involves sales of taxable items;
    • (D) uses independent salespersons in direct sales of taxable items;
    • (E) derives receipts from a rental or lease of tangible personal property that is located in this state;
    • (F) allows a franchisee or licensee to operate under its trade name if the franchisee or licensee is required to collect Texas sales or use tax; or
    • (G) conducts business in this state through employees, agents, or independent contractors.
  • The Texas state sales and use tax rate is 6.25% since 1990, but local taxing jurisdictions (cities, counties, special purpose districts, and transit authorities, but specifically not including school districts) may also impose sales and use taxes up to 2% for a total of 8.25%.The main items exempt from Sales Tax (get Seller's Permit) include medicines (prescription and over-the-counter), food and food seeds (but prepared food, such as from a restaurant, is subject to Sales Tax (get Seller's Permit) ).

    Motor vehicle and boat sales are taxed at only the 6.25% state rate; there is no local sales and use tax on these items. In addition, a motor vehicle or boat purchased outside the state is assessed a use tax at the same rate as one purchased inside the state. The Sales Tax (get Seller's Permit) is calculated on the greater of either the actual purchase price or the "standard presumptive value" of the vehicle, as determined by the state, except for certain purchases (mainly purchases from licensed dealers or from auctions).

    Lodging rates are subject to a 6% rate at the state level, with local entities being allowed to charge additional amounts. For example, the city of Austin levies a 9% hotel/motel tax, bringing the total to 15%, trailing only Houston for the highest total lodging tax statewide, at 17%.Lodging for travelers on official government business is specifically exempt from tax but the traveler must submit an exemption form to the hotel/motel and provide proof of official status.

    If merchants file and pay their sales and use tax on time, they may subtract 1/2 percent of the tax collected as a discount, to encourage prompt payment and to compensate the merchant for collecting the tax from consumers for the state.

    Texas provides one Sales Tax (get Seller's Permit) holiday per year (generally in August prior to the start of the school year, running from Friday to Sunday of the designated weekend). Clothing less than $100 (except for certain items, such as golf shoes) and school supplies are exempt from all Sales Tax (get Seller's Permit) (state and local) on this one weekend only. There has also been talk of a tax free weekend in December to help with the Holiday shopping season.

    5. Is there a fee charged for a Texas sales and use tax permit?
    There is no fee for the Texas Sales and Use tax permit. However, based on your application, you could be required to post a security bond and we also charge you a fee $39 to help you file it.
    6. If I am no longer in business, can I keep my Sales Tax (get Seller's Permit) permit?
    Your permit is valid only as long as you are actively engaged in business as a seller. If you are no longer conducting business, you should return your permit to the Comptroller for cancellation. Likewise, the Comptroller may cancel your permit if it finds that you are no longer engaged in business as a seller.
    7. Once I have obtained a Texas sales and use tax permit, what are my obligations as a permit holder?
    As a permit holder, you are required to
    • Post your permit at your place of business;
    • Collect Sales Tax (get Seller's Permit) on all taxable sales;
    • Pay sales and use tax on all taxable purchases;
    • Timely report and pay sales and use taxes; and
    • Keep adequate records.

    What is sales use tax? ; A sales use tax is a tax on out of state purchases of taxable items. So for example if you live in CA and you buy a computer from Nevada online from the internet - even though you do not pay Nevada tax you will need to pay CA tax. States that have sales tax also have use tax so you pay sales tax of taxable purchases regardless of what state you buy even if that state does not charge you taxes.
